Maya Angelou passed away this morning at the age of 86 in her home in Winston-Salem, N.C. The cause of death is unknown, but her literary agent Helen Brann says she's been dealing with bad health for some time.  Today, the country loses one of its national treasures. Poet, activist, teacher, novelist, Angelou did it all. Angelou rose to fame in 1969 with her autobiography I Know Why The Caged Bird Sings, which documented her childhood in the Jim Crow South. The rest is history as Maya Angelou would become one of the most influential poets of her generation.
